Mill Valley, CA Dance fever swept Mill Valley Middle School as 6th, 7th and 8th graders completed a unique 5-week dance course taught by celebrated dance coach and choreographer Cynthia Glinka of Larkspur.

Glinka taught nearly 700 students the SWING, FOX TROT and RUMBA and on June 15, 2009 the program culminated with the entire school performing a DISCO line dance on the outdoor court, followed by a lunch-hour dance in the gym with music provided by the Mill Valley Middle School Jazz Band.
